Understanding the Core Features of Rubber Recycling Plants

Rubber recycling plants are designed to process scrap tires and other rubber products into valuable materials that can be repurposed. The key features of these plants include advanced shredding technologies, granulation equipment, and separation systems that efficiently extract steel and fiber from rubber. Typically, the machinery adheres to industry standards, featuring high throughput rates, energy-efficient operations, and low emissions to meet stringent environmental regulations.

Moreover, modern rubber recycling plants are equipped with state-of-the-art monitoring systems that ensure optimal operational performance and safety. These features position them as essential tools in the circular economy, where the focus is on minimizing waste and reusing materials.

Advantages and Applications of Rubber Recycling Plants

The advantages of investing in a rubber recycling plant are significant. First and foremost, these facilities help mitigate environmental pollution by recycling around 60% of the rubber used in tires—an enormous volume given that approximately 1.5 billion tires are discarded annually. This process not only conserves natural resources but also reduces greenhouse gas emissions associated with rubber production.

Additionally, the repurposed rubber can be utilized in various applications, such as asphalt, playground surfaces, and flooring materials, thereby creating new markets and revenue streams. The versatility of recycled rubber makes it an attractive feedstock for diverse industries, from construction to automotive.
